Elaine Kerndt, 59, Tishomingo County Tragedy; Missing Found Dead After Search
The quiet community of Tishomingo County has been left in deep sorrow following the loss of Elaine Kerndt, 59, whose body was found in Bay Springs Lake after an overnight search that ended in heartbreak.
Elaine had been reported missing after her vehicle was discovered abandoned on the Waterway Bridge along Highway 30 near Paden. The discovery quickly raised concern among loved ones and authorities, prompting an urgent and coordinated search effort. Deputies, rescue teams, and dive personnel worked through the night, holding onto hope that she would be found safe.
By morning, that hope gave way to grief as search teams recovered her from the lake, confirming the worst fears of those waiting for answers.
